Hi,

I've got a GCC-4240N C102 in my ThinkPad T30 (this was what IBM put in my machine after my last one was defective).

I can't seem to find a patch for C102 and the latest firmwares from IBM's website don't want to update my drive. Any ideas?

None of the firmware's on IBM site are compatible, and frankly look to be much older. This is most likely a GCC-4243N tweaked to report as a 4240N. Please email us and we'll try and figure a solution.
